Benefits Of Pomegranate


Pomegranate is full of important nutrients like vitamins C, B, potassium, folic acid, iron and fiber. Pomegranate juice contains more than 100 phytochemicals.

Pomegranate helps build immunity, prevent cancer and boost memory. Pomegranate contains nutrients and anti-oxidants that keep cells from getting damaged. Nutritionists recommend eating this fruit daily. Some of the benefits of pomegranate are…

Increases memory

Pomegranate pearls are red in color because of the polyphenols they contain. Pomegranate juice is full of polyphenols, which help in improving memory. A study revealed that people who drank pomegranate juice daily had more memory than others. Drinking a cup of pomegranate juice daily in the morning improves memory.

Prevents blood pressure and heart diseases

Pomegranate juice is used as an excellent remedy for protecting heart health. Pomegranate juice helps regulate blood flow to the heart and prevent blood vessels from constricting. It also helps in reducing blood cholesterol. However, pomegranate juice is likely to have negative effects on people taking pills to lower blood pressure and cholesterol. So, people with high blood pressure can drink pomegranate juice after consulting a doctor. Pomegranate helps protect against blood pressure and heart diseases.

Prevents cancers

Pomegranate prevents the formation of certain types of cancer. This fruit has anti-inflammatory properties and is rich in polyphenols, which slow down the growth of cancer cells. Also, it prevents cancer from spreading. Research results suggest that pomegranate fruit has the ability to fight against breast, lung and prostate cancers.

Arthritis, joint pain relief

The anti-inflammatory properties of pomegranate help control arthritis and protect against joint pain. Pomegranate juice helps in removing the clogging enzymes that damage the joints. Additionally, pomegranates have powerful anti-inflammatory properties due to their high antioxidant content. Hence, this fruit helps in reducing body inflammation.

Rich in vitamins

Pomegranate contains vitamin C, vitamin E, folate, potassium and vitamin K. When drinking pomegranate juice, it is best to drink it without added sugar. One cup of pomegranate pearls is rich in 0.04 percent of fiber, 0.017 percent of protein, 30 percent of vitamin C, 36 percent of vitamin K, 16 percent of folate, and 12 percent of potassium.

Bone health

A 2013 study suggests that pomegranates also help reduce bone wear and tear. This is also due to the powerful antioxidants present in pomegranate. You can make it a habit to eat pomegranate fruit daily to keep your bones healthy.
